Cadets bring holiday cheer to children in need

December 15th, 2009
U.S. Air Force Academy Cadets sponsored the "Toy Trick," an event to gather toys for less fortunate children, at the Falcons hockey team's match against American International College Dec. 5 in the Cadet Ice Arena here. 

After the Falcons scored their first goal, fans tossed donated toys onto the ice.

The Toy Trick program started 10 years ago and has collected about 5,000 toys for local children from 1999 to 2008. Cadet 2nd Class Derrick Burnett estimated the Dec. 5 toss at about 1,000 toys.
